The window service market for Lecompte residents is intrinsically linked to the broader Alexandria, LA area. The competition is moderate, featuring a mix of national franchise providers (like Window World) and established local or regional specialists (like Pella and Pelican). Quality varies significantly, with a clear distinction between value-oriented vinyl replacement and high-end custom or impact-resistant solutions. Typical pricing reflects this range; a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ement can start from $400-$700 per window installed, while high-performance, custom, or impact-resistant windows can easily range from $900 to $1,500+ per window. Homeowners in Lecompte are advised to seek multiple quotes and verify licensing and insurance, given the mix of large-scale operators and smaller local craftsmen serving the region.

For a standard single-family home in Lecompte,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number and size of windows. Key cost factors include the window material (vinyl is popular for its affordability and low maintenance), the style (e.g., double-hung vs. picture windows), and the energy efficiency features needed for our humid, subtropical climate. Additional costs can arise from repairing rotted wood frames common in older Louisiana homes or upgrading to impact-resistant glass for storm protection.
Lecompte's hot, humid summers and mild but occasionally stormy winters make high-performance windows crucial. We strongly recommend windows with Low-E glass coatings and argon gas fills to block significant solar heat gain and reduce cooling costs. Given our high humidity and potential for heavy rain, look for windows with excellent weather sealing and durable, moisture-resistant materials like vinyl or fiberglass to prevent warping and mold growth.
In unincorporated areas of Rapides Parish (which includes Lecompte), a building permit is generally not required for a like-for-like window replacement that doesn't alter the structural framing. However, if you are changing the window size or shape, a permit is necessary. It's always best to verify with the Rapides Parish Planning and Zoning Department, and a reputable local installer will handle this process for you. Additionally, if you're in a historic district, there may be aesthetic guidelines.
The ideal installation windows are during our milder seasons: late fall (October-November) and early spring (March-April). This avoids the peak humidity and frequent afternoon thunderstorms of summer, as well as the occasional freezing rain or storms in winter. Scheduling during these drier, temperate periods helps ensure the installation is efficient and allows for proper sealing of the window frames without weather interference.
Always ask for their Louisiana State Licensing Board for Contractors license number; residential window installation requires a Home Improvement registration at minimum. Verify this license online via the LSLBC website. Also, seek out local references in the Lecompte or Alexandria area and check for positive reviews that mention handling our specific climate challenges. A trustworthy provider will also carry general liability and workers' compensation insurance to protect your home.
